Class Hierarchy
- java.lang.Object
- net.emaze.dysfunctional.ranges.DenseRange<T> (implements net.emaze.dysfunctional.ranges.Range<T>)
- net.emaze.dysfunctional.ranges.Densify<T> (implements net.emaze.dysfunctional.dispatching.delegates.Delegate<R,T>)
- net.emaze.dysfunctional.ranges.Difference<T> (implements net.emaze.dysfunctional.dispatching.delegates.BinaryDelegate<R,T1,T2>)
- net.emaze.dysfunctional.ranges.Intersection<T> (implements net.emaze.dysfunctional.dispatching.delegates.BinaryDelegate<R,T1,T2>)
- net.emaze.dysfunctional.ranges.MakeRange<T> (implements net.emaze.dysfunctional.dispatching.delegates.Delegate<R,T>)
- net.emaze.dysfunctional.ranges.RangeComparator<T> (implements java.util.Comparator<T>, java.io.Serializable)
- net.emaze.dysfunctional.ranges.RangeIsEmpty<R,T> (implements net.emaze.dysfunctional.dispatching.logic.Predicate<E>)
- net.emaze.dysfunctional.ranges.RangeIterator<T> (implements java.util.Iterator<E>)
- net.emaze.dysfunctional.ranges.RangeNotContaining<T> (implements net.emaze.dysfunctional.dispatching.logic.Predicate<E>)
- net.emaze.dysfunctional.ranges.RangeOverlappingWith<R,T> (implements net.emaze.dysfunctional.dispatching.logic.Predicate<E>)
- net.emaze.dysfunctional.ranges.SparseRange<T> (implements net.emaze.dysfunctional.ranges.Range<T>)
- net.emaze.dysfunctional.ranges.SymmetricDifference<T> (implements net.emaze.dysfunctional.dispatching.delegates.BinaryDelegate<R,T1,T2>)
- net.emaze.dysfunctional.ranges.Union<T> (implements net.emaze.dysfunctional.dispatching.delegates.BinaryDelegate<R,T1,T2>)
Interface Hierarchy
Enum Hierarchy
Copyright © 2013. All rights reserved.